The Rise of DevOps as a Game-Changer

Adoption Trends and Growth Metrics

DevOps has seen remarkable uptake across industries, with adoption rates reflecting its undeniable value. According to recent industry benchmarks like the DORA State of DevOps Report in 2025, top-performing teams consistently achieve deployment frequencies and lead times that outpace traditional models, often delivering updates multiple times daily. This data underscores a shift toward continuous integration and delivery as standard practices among leading organizations.

The reliance on automation tools further illustrates this trend’s momentum. Platforms such as Jenkins for pipeline management, Docker for containerization, and Kubernetes for orchestration have become integral to workflows, enabling seamless scaling and error reduction. Surveys indicate that over 80% of enterprises now incorporate at least one of these tools, a clear sign of DevOps’ pervasive influence on operational efficiency.

Moreover, the correlation between DevOps practices and business outcomes is striking. Metrics reveal that teams embracing these methods not only accelerate delivery but also enhance software quality and boost customer satisfaction by minimizing downtime and defects. This convergence of speed and reliability positions DevOps as a strategic imperative for any forward-thinking company.

Real-World Impact and Case Studies

The tangible benefits of DevOps come to life through its application in diverse settings. A prominent tech giant, for instance, revamped its release cycle by adopting continuous integration and delivery pipelines, enabling daily updates to millions of users with minimal disruption. This shift slashed deployment times while maintaining system stability, showcasing the power of streamlined processes.

In another example, a fast-growing startup leveraged containerization to scale its infrastructure dynamically. By using tools like Docker, the company managed sudden spikes in user demand without over-investing in hardware, demonstrating how DevOps supports agility in resource-constrained environments. Such adaptability is a hallmark of this approach, proving its relevance beyond large corporations.

These cases highlight a broader truth: DevOps is not a theoretical concept but a practical solution with measurable outcomes. From accelerated releases to enhanced reliability, the methodology validates its promise across different scales and sectors, reinforcing its status as a pivotal element in software innovation.

Expert Perspectives on DevOps Significance

Industry leaders consistently emphasize the indispensable role of DevOps in navigating the complexities of modern software demands. Many point to its ability to foster a unified environment where development and operations teams share goals, breaking down longstanding barriers that hinder progress. This cultural alignment, they argue, is often the linchpin of successful implementation.

However, challenges remain a frequent topic of discussion among professionals. Cultural resistance to collaboration frequently surfaces as a hurdle, with some organizations struggling to shift from siloed mindsets. Additionally, the intricacy of integrating automation tools into legacy systems poses technical difficulties, requiring both skill and patience to overcome, as noted by several thought leaders.

Looking ahead, experts predict that DevOps will continue to drive competitive advantage through sustained innovation. They stress that its long-term impact lies in enabling organizations to adapt swiftly to market shifts while maintaining high standards of quality. Such insights affirm the methodology’s enduring relevance in an ever-evolving technological landscape.

Future Outlook for DevOps in Software Development

As DevOps matures, its evolution is poised to incorporate cutting-edge advancements like artificial intelligence for predictive analytics. Such integration could anticipate system failures or performance bottlenecks before they occur, further reducing downtime and enhancing efficiency. The potential for AI-driven automation to refine decision-making processes marks an exciting frontier for this field.

Anticipated benefits include even shorter delivery cycles and improved scalability to meet fluctuating demands. Yet, challenges loom, particularly around security in rapid deployment environments. Balancing speed with robust safeguards against vulnerabilities will be critical to sustaining trust and stability as practices advance over the coming years.

Beyond technical spheres, the influence of DevOps is expected to ripple across industries like healthcare, finance, and e-commerce, reshaping operational models. While this promises greater responsiveness to consumer needs, there’s a risk of over-reliance on tools at the expense of cultural transformation. Addressing this balance will determine how effectively sectors harness these capabilities without compromising foundational teamwork.
